Are you contemplating whether to pursue a freelance career or stick to a full-time job? This decision can be challenging, especially if you are just starting out in your career. Both have their advantages and disadvantages, and it is essential to weigh them carefully before making a decision.

Flexibility

One of the biggest advantages of freelancing is the flexibility it offers. You get to choose your working hours and decide when to take breaks. With a full-time job, you have to adhere to a strict schedule, which can be limiting. However, this flexibility can also be a disadvantage as it requires a lot of self-discipline and time management skills to ensure that you meet your deadlines.

Income Stability

A full-time job provides a sense of financial security as you are assured of a regular paycheck. Freelancing, on the other hand, can be unpredictable, and your income can vary from month to month. You need to have a reliable client base and manage your finances well to ensure that you have a stable income as a freelancer.

Benefits

Full-time jobs usually come with benefits such as health insurance, retirement plans, and paid time off. As a freelancer, you have to provide these benefits for yourself, which can be expensive. However, freelancers have the advantage of deducting some of their expenses from their taxes, such as home office expenses, equipment, and supplies.

Career Growth

Full-time jobs provide opportunities for career growth, such as promotions, training, and mentorship programs. Freelancers have to create their own professional development plans and invest in their education and training to stay competitive in their industry.

Work-Life Balance

Freelancing offers the advantage of a better work-life balance as you can choose to work from home or any location of your choice. This saves you commuting time and allows you to spend more time with your family and friends. Full-time jobs usually require you to be present in the office for a specific period, which can be challenging if you have other commitments.

Job Security

Full-time jobs provide job security as long as you perform well and the company is doing well financially. Freelancers have to constantly look for new clients and projects to ensure that they have a steady income. However, freelancers have the advantage of diversifying their income streams and not relying on one employer.

Skills and Expertise

Full-time jobs provide opportunities for learning and acquiring new skills from experienced colleagues and mentors. Freelancers have to invest in their professional development and create their own learning opportunities. However, freelancers have the advantage of specializing in a particular niche and becoming experts in their field.

Networking

Full-time jobs provide opportunities for networking with colleagues and industry professionals. Freelancers have to create their own networking opportunities and attend events and conferences to meet potential clients and collaborators. However, freelancers have the advantage of working with clients from different industries and expanding their network beyond their immediate colleagues.

Job Satisfaction

Full-time jobs provide a sense of belonging to a team and contributing to a larger organization’s goals. Freelancers have the advantage of choosing the projects they want to work on and working on something they are passionate about. However, freelancers can also experience isolation and lack of feedback, which can affect their motivation and job satisfaction.

Conclusion

Whether to pursue a freelance or full-time career depends on your personality, lifestyle, and career goals. Freelancing offers the advantage of flexibility, work-life balance, and job satisfaction, while full-time jobs provide financial security, benefits, and opportunities for career growth. It is important to weigh the advantages and disadvantages carefully and choose the option that best suits your needs and aspirations.
